Children’s Choirs

Our children’s choir season begins in September and ends in May.

Click here for important children's choir dates.

Small Grace Choir This precious choir is for children ages 2 yrs.—4 yrs. They meet on select Sundays and practice for the last 15 minutes of the 9:45 Sunday school hour. The kids perform at several worship services and special events throughout the year. Every child who would like to participate is welcome and invited to do so.

Cherub Choir This choir is for kids in Kindergarten through 2nd grade. Rehearsals take place most Wednesday nights @ 6:30 pm—7:30 pm upstairs in our loft area. Our Cherubs perform during several worship services and special events throughout the year.

Lord’s Children’s Choir All kids in 3rd—6th grades are invited to join our Lord’s Children’s Choir. Rehearsals take place most Wednesday nights @ 6:30 pm—7:30 pm upstairs in our loft area. This choir performs during several worship services and special events throughout the year.

Sunday School

Our Sunday school program is designed with the whole family in mind. We offer a lectionary series curriculum program the appeals to all the learning styles of children at 9:30am and 11am. Our teachers are dedicated and caring—they make Sunday school a place of love and safety for all the children who attend Alliance. Our goal is for each child to leave class with the message that God loves them! They will color, cut, paste, read stories, play games, read the Bible, share prayers, eat snacks, paint and even plant seeds along the way, but it all boils down to that fundamental message of God’s enduring love.

Confirmation

Beginning in January of each year, children of confirmation age are given the opportunity to participate in an exciting confirmation program.  The program goes through May and includes field trips, mentor meetings and fellowship.  It is an essential part of the spiritual formation of our children as they work with the pastor, staff and (adult) friends of faith.  At the end of confirmation, the kids are given the opportunity to make an informed adult profession of faith.
